Wiktionary
GREGARIOUS, adjective. (of a person) Describing one who enjoys being in crowds and socializing.
GREGARIOUS, adjective. (zoology) Of animals that travel in herds or packs.
Dictionary definition
GREGARIOUS, adjective. (of animals) tending to form a group with others of the same species; "gregarious bird species".
GREGARIOUS, adjective. Instinctively or temperamentally seeking and enjoying the company of others; "he is a gregarious person who avoids solitude".
GREGARIOUS, adjective. (of plants) growing in groups that are close together.
